对象存储文件管理,对象存储与文件存储的关系
- 综合资讯
- 2024-09-28 22:23:59
- 5

对象存储文件管理是一种针对对象存储的管理方式。对象存储是一种将数据存储为对象的技术,每个对象都有唯一的标识符。对象存储文件管理主要包括对象的创建、读取、更新和删除等操作...
***:对象存储文件管理是一种针对对象存储的文件管理方式。对象存储是一种将数据存储为对象的存储技术,而文件存储则是将数据存储为文件的存储技术。对象存储文件管理与文件存储有着密切的关系。对象存储文件管理可以提供类似于文件存储的文件管理功能,如文件的创建、读取、写入、删除等。对象存储文件管理也可以提供一些文件存储所不具备的功能,如对象的版本控制、访问控制、数据加密等。
标题:对象存储与文件存储:差异、关系与应用场景
一、引言
在当今数字化时代,数据存储是企业和组织不可或缺的一部分,随着数据量的不断增长,存储技术也在不断发展和演进,对象存储和文件存储是两种常见的存储方式,它们在数据管理、性能、成本等方面有着不同的特点和应用场景,本文将探讨对象存储与文件存储的关系,包括它们的定义、特点、差异以及如何根据实际需求选择合适的存储方式。
二、对象存储与文件存储的定义
(一)对象存储
对象存储是一种将数据作为对象进行存储和管理的技术,每个对象都包含数据本身、元数据(如文件名、大小、创建时间等)以及一个唯一的标识符,对象存储通常采用分布式架构,将数据分布在多个存储节点上,以提高可靠性和性能。
(二)文件存储
文件存储是一种将数据组织成文件的存储方式,文件存储通常基于文件系统,将数据按照一定的目录结构进行组织和管理,文件存储可以提供对文件的随机访问和顺序访问,适用于存储大量的小文件。
三、对象存储与文件存储的特点
(一)对象存储的特点
1、高可靠性:对象存储通常采用分布式架构,将数据分布在多个存储节点上,通过冗余和备份机制来保证数据的可靠性。
2、高扩展性:对象存储可以根据数据量的增长动态地增加存储节点,实现横向扩展,以满足不断增长的存储需求。
3、高性能:对象存储通常采用分布式架构和并行处理技术,能够提供高并发的读写性能,适用于处理大量的小文件和大数据流。
4、灵活的访问方式:对象存储提供了多种访问方式,如 HTTP/HTTPS、RESTful API 等,方便用户通过网络进行访问和管理。
5、成本效益高:对象存储可以根据实际使用情况进行计费,避免了传统存储方式中因容量预留而造成的资源浪费。
(二)文件存储的特点
1、简单易用:文件存储基于文件系统,用户可以像使用本地文件一样使用存储中的文件,操作简单方便。
2、支持随机访问:文件存储可以提供对文件的随机访问,适用于需要频繁访问特定文件的应用场景。
3、适合存储大量小文件:文件存储可以有效地存储大量的小文件,并且可以提供较好的性能。
4、数据一致性高:文件存储通常采用文件系统的一致性机制,保证数据的一致性和完整性。
5、成本相对较低:文件存储的成本相对较低,适用于对存储成本敏感的应用场景。
四、对象存储与文件存储的差异
(一)数据组织方式
对象存储将数据作为对象进行存储和管理,每个对象都包含数据本身、元数据以及一个唯一的标识符,文件存储则将数据组织成文件,按照一定的目录结构进行存储和管理。
(二)访问方式
对象存储提供了多种访问方式,如 HTTP/HTTPS、RESTful API 等,方便用户通过网络进行访问和管理,文件存储则通常通过文件系统的接口进行访问,如文件读取、写入、删除等。
(三)性能特点
对象存储通常采用分布式架构和并行处理技术,能够提供高并发的读写性能,适用于处理大量的小文件和大数据流,文件存储则更适合存储大量的小文件,并且可以提供较好的性能。
(四)适用场景
对象存储适用于处理大量的小文件、大数据流、非结构化数据等场景,如图片、视频、音频等,文件存储则适用于存储大量的小文件、文档、数据库文件等场景。
五、如何选择合适的存储方式
(一)根据数据特点选择
如果数据是大量的小文件、非结构化数据或者需要高并发的读写性能,那么对象存储可能是更好的选择,如果数据是大量的小文件、文档或者需要较好的性能,那么文件存储可能是更好的选择。
(二)根据应用场景选择
如果应用场景是互联网、云计算、大数据等,那么对象存储可能是更好的选择,如果应用场景是企业内部的文件管理、文档存储等,那么文件存储可能是更好的选择。
(三)根据成本考虑
如果对存储成本敏感,那么对象存储可能是更好的选择,因为它可以根据实际使用情况进行计费,避免了传统存储方式中因容量预留而造成的资源浪费。
六、结论
对象存储和文件存储是两种常见的存储方式,它们在数据管理、性能、成本等方面有着不同的特点和应用场景,在选择存储方式时,需要根据数据特点、应用场景和成本等因素进行综合考虑,选择最适合的存储方式,随着技术的不断发展和应用场景的不断拓展,对象存储和文件存储的应用将会越来越广泛,它们将为企业和组织的数据管理提供更加高效、可靠和灵活的解决方案。
本文链接:https://zhitaoyun.cn/16947.html
发表评论